    Abstract

    A faucet shield includes a semi-rigid panel having an opening disposed therewithin and defined by an upper section and a lower section. The lower section attaches and conforms to a plumbing fixture and the opening fits around a faucet of the plumbing fixture, thereby shielding an area about the faucet. In some embodiments, the faucet shield attaches to a sink faucet to prevent water from being splashed onto nearby countertops, walls, floors, etc.

    DETAILED DESCRIPTION

    [0018] As discussed above, embodiments of the present disclosure relate to plumbing fixture accessories and more particularly to a faucet shield. Generally, the faucet shield attaches about a plumbing fixture faucet to prevent water from being splashed onto nearby areas. Particularly, the plumbing fixture may be a sink. As such, the faucet shield may protect countertops, floors and walls behind kitchen sinks, bathroom sinks, laundry room sinks, etc. Further, the faucet shield may be used with restaurant kitchen sinks to protect food preparation areas from contaminants.

    [0019] In some embodiments, the shield may include a rectangular semi-rigid silicone panel with a self-healing opening in a center thereof to enable accurate fitting of any faucet style. The opening may attach over the faucet and the semi-rigid silicone sheet may mold to the sink and extend above the sink to prevent the water from reaching the surrounding countertop. The faucet shield system may preferably be provided in a variety of sizes.

    [0021] As shown in FIGS. 1-3, the shield 100 may include a panel 110 including an upper section 111, a lower section 112, a left side 113 and a right side 114 relative to the faucet 5 and an opening 115 disposed within the panel 110 configured to receive the faucet 5 therethrough. In some embodiments, the upper section 111 and the lower section 112 may be equal in size and shape and as such may define two halves of the panel 110.

    [0022] As shown more particularly in FIGS. 1-2, the panel 110 may be rectangular in shape when in a relaxed position (i.e., when not conforming to or attached to the plumbing fixture 6) and substantially planar. Further, as shown in FIG. 1, the opening 115 may in some embodiments be located at a center of the panel 110 and may include an oblong or rounded rectangular shape, with a length of the opening 115 oriented parallel to a length of the panel 110. This may enable the opening 115 to receive the faucet 5 and, in some embodiments, handles of the faucet 5 also. It should however be appreciated that the panel 110 and the opening 115 are not limited to these shapes or configurations.

    [0023] As shown in FIGS. 3-5, the shield 100 may be particularly used for shielding the sides and rear of a plumbing fixture 6 to which the faucet 5 is attached. More specifically, as discussed above and as shown in these figures, the plumbing fixture 6 may be a sink. As such, when a user uses the faucet 5, water is prevented from pooling on a countertop 10 (or other surface surrounding the sink). As particularly shown in FIGS. 4-5, the lower section 112 may be configured to conformingly attach to interior sides and rear of the plumbing fixture 6. The upper section 111 may extend vertically and upwardly from the plumbing fixture 6 when the lower section 112 is attached thereto, thereby shielding the area (again such as a countertop 10) behind the sides and rear of the plumbing fixture 6 from water splashed from the faucet 5.

    [0024] To conformingly attach to the plumbing fixture 6, the panel 110 may be of semi-rigid construction, having enough pliability to allow the panel 110 to conform to the plumbing fixture 6 (for example, to conform to a curvature of a rounded sink) to completely shield 100 the area behind the sides and rear of the panel 110, whilst having enough rigidity to allow the panel 110 to support itself adequately, preventing the upper section 111 from bending or warping under its own weight. Accordingly, in some embodiments, the panel 110 may be constructed from a silicone material.

    [0025] As above, the opening 115 in the panel 110 may be configured to receive the faucet 5 therethrough, facilitating the attachment of the panel 110 to the plumbing fixture 6. In some embodiments, the opening 115 may be a ‘self-healing’ opening 115. Particularly, in some embodiments, a peripheral edge of the opening 115 may include one or more self-healing materials configured to conform to the faucet 5 (and in some embodiments, handles of the faucet 5). For example, the self-healing material may include polymers, elastomers, or the like. In this embodiment, once the opening 115 is attached over the faucet 5 (or the faucet 5 is inserted through the opening 115), the opening 115 may close around the faucet 5, creating a snug fit therearound. This may enable the shield 100 to be used with faucets 5 of a variety of sizes and styles. It should however be appreciated that the means of fastening the panel 110 to the plumbing fixture 6 is not limited to the self-healing properties of the opening 115.

    [0026] Further, to aid in the universal use of the shield 100, the shield 100 may be provided in a variety of sizes. For example, the shield 100 may be provided in a small, medium and large size. As such, the shield 100 may be used with differently sized plumbing fixtures 6. For example, a small shield may be used for a bathroom sink; and a large shield may be used for a kitchen sink.

    [0027] In use, a user may attach the shield 100 to the faucet 5 by placing the opening 115 over the faucet 5 and inserting the faucet 5 (and in some embodiments, handles of the faucet 5) therethrough. The lower section 112 may conformingly attach to the interior sides and rear of the plumbing fixture 6 and the opening 115 may surround the faucet 5. Particularly, in some embodiments, the opening 115 may ‘self-heal’ to conform to the faucet 5, thereby closing any gap left between the opening 115 and the faucet 5. The upper section 111 of the panel 110 may then shield the area behind and to the sides of the faucet 5 from water splashed from the faucet 5.
